◆(3):如果是操作系统的重新安装,只要是同样系统,同样数据库版本,是可以做冷备恢复。一下谈的是系统的重新安装后的步骤。◆(4):正常安装oracle软件,只需要安装软件,可以不用建实例,建实例的时间也比较长,也没有必要。 软件安装好以后,开始准备恢复。
数据库备份备份分为物理备份和逻辑备份。物理备份分为归档模式备份(热备份)和非归档模式备份(冷备份)。归档模式备份在数据库运行时进行,非归档模式备份在关闭数据库后执行。冷备份(脱机备份)通过shutdown命令停止服务,然后复制数据文件和控制文件,以备不时之需。
Oracle数据库有三种标准的备份方法,它们分别是导出/导入(EXP/IMP)、热备份和冷备份。导出备件是一种逻辑备份,冷备份和热备份是物理备份。 导出/导入(Export/Import)利用Export可将数据从数据库中提取出来,利用Import则可将提取出来的数据送回到Oracle数据库中去。
oracle 数据库有三种标准的备份方法,它们分别为导出/导入(export/import)、冷备份、热备份。导出备份是一种逻辑备份,冷备份和热备份是物理备份。--- 导出/导入(export/import)--- 利用export可将数据从数据库中提取出来,利用import则可将提取出来的数据送回oracle数据库中去。
逻辑备份:是利用sql语言从数据库中抽取数据并存于二进制文件的过程。第一类为物理备份,该方法实现数据库的完整恢复,但数据库必须运行在归挡模式下(业务数据库在非归挡模式下运行),且需要极大的外部存储设备,例如磁带库,具体包括冷备份和热备份。
实现步骤:包括打包数据文件、复制并解压到备用位置、更新配置文件以及恢复时的解锁表和复制回数据、日志文件等步骤。 注意事项:冷备份虽然操作相对简单,但恢复过程可能较为复杂,且服务中断对业务影响较大。 温备份 定义:温备份是在数据库读写操作过程中进行的增量备份,介于热备份和冷备份之间。
为了实现Oracle数据库在晚上12点自动备份,您可以选择两种方式:操作系统级别的计划任务或数据库内部的备份机制。首先,对于操作系统级别的计划任务,您需要创建一个备份脚本。这个脚本将包含备份数据库的命令。然后,您可以在操作系统的任务计划中设置这个脚本定时执行。
oracle数据库怎么自动备份?需要写个bat脚本,然后在windows计划任务里调用此脚本可实现每天自动备份。
在linux环境下,常见数据库如Oracle、MySQL、POSTgreSQL和MongoDB的备份,可以通过编写特定的脚本并利用crontab来实现。例如,对于Oracle数据库,可以编写一个脚本执行RMAN备份;对于MySQL数据库,可以使用mysqldump工具;对于PostgreSQL数据库,可以使用pg_dump命令;对于MongoDB数据库,则可以使用mongodump命令。
1、为了实现Oracle数据库在晚上12点自动备份,您可以选择两种方式:操作系统级别的计划任务或数据库内部的备份机制。首先,对于操作系统级别的计划任务,您需要创建一个备份脚本。这个脚本将包含备份数据库的命令。然后,您可以在操作系统的任务计划中设置这个脚本定时执行。
2、为了确保在每天的凌晨1点执行备份任务,可以创建一个备份脚本并将其保存在/home路径下。例如,创建一个名为backup.sh的脚本,然后在crontab中添加相应的定时任务。实现定时备份的步骤包括:检查crond服务是否启动、创建备份脚本、给脚本增加执行权限、设置定时任务crontab。
3、加入调度在windows中用任务计划向导即可,或使用at命令。在unix中,在目标机器上编写一个文件,用以启动Oracle自动备份进程。
4、oracle数据库怎么自动备份?需要写个bat脚本,然后在windows计划任务里调用此脚本可实现每天自动备份。
5、在Oracle数据库中,实现修改前自动备份修改数据的功能,可以通过创建触发器(Trigger)来实现。触发器是一种特殊类型的存储过程,它会在指定的数据库事件发生时自动执行。具体而言,可以创建一个BEFORE UPDATE触发器,该触发器在数据被更新之前自动执行,将原始数据备份到另一个表中或导出为文件。
采用RMAN方式备份Oracle数据库是常用且高效的方法。RMAN作为Oracle的备份还原与恢复工具,通过命令行界面操作,与EXP/EXPDP工具相比,它进行的是物理备份,而非逻辑备份。具体操作步骤如下:首先,确定备份路径。这里推荐将备份数据存放在专用的备份服务器上。通过挂载方式,使CentOS服务器能够访问该存储位置。
第一类为物理备份,该方法实现数据库的完整恢复,但数据库必须运行在归挡模式下(业务数据库在非归挡模式下运行),且需要极大的外部存储设备,例如磁带库;第二类备份方式为逻辑备份,业务数据库采用此种方式,此方法不需要数据库运行在归挡模式下,不但备份简单,而且可以不需要外部存储设备。
RMAN技术 RMAN是Oracle公司提供的备份与恢复工具,集成到数据库管理中,简化备份与恢复流程,提高数据库备份效率与可靠性。RMAN主要解决数据库备份与恢复过程中的问题,通过物理与逻辑备份策略,满足不同场景的需求。
以Oracle用户身份登录数据库服务器或通过网络连接。 进入ORACLE数据备份工具RMAN。 在命令窗口中执行以下命令:```DELETE ARCHIVELOG ALL COMPLETED BEFORE SYSDATE-7;```其中`SYSDATE-7`表示删除7天前的归档日志。
使用RMAN清楚物理删除后的记录可以使用RMAN来删除archivelog,具体可以按以下步骤操作:物理删除archivelog进入RMANcrosscheck archivelog all;delete expried archivelog all;这样就在一些Oracle的记录中查不到相应的archivelog记录了。